Le jeu. 2 janv. 2020 à 18:24, Yves P. a écrit :
> @Philippe
>
> "opening_hours" est conçu n'importe comment, pas pour être lisible, et
> plein d’ambiguïtés
>
>
> C’est un langage de programmation (une grammaire) conçue pour être
> indépendante de la langue, fonctionner avec tous les cas de
@Jérôme
> Dans ce cas il faut utiliser le || et non ;
Je ne connaissais (ou me rappelais) pas cette règle. Elle simplifie bien les
chose parfois.
Elle pourrait-être utilisée pour les horaires de la piscine pour les journées
continues pendant les vacances scolaires.
(pas sûr qu’on descende à
Voilà comment une spécif est devenue illisible et c'est à moi qu'on vient
dire que supprimer les espaces non nécessaires serait illisible?
Il y a trop de règles ici, le "fallback" (||) ne sert à rien et complique
inutilement, la syntaxe indiquée n'étant même pas correctement spécifiée en
terme
C'est un truc de fou quand même d'être aussi têtu!
Tu me parles du comportement du mot clé *off. *Ca n'a rien à avoir avec ce
que je mentionne!
Pour rappel ta proposition c'est ça à la base
*Mo-Fr 11:45-14:00,17:00-20:00;*
*We 11:30-11:45; < ici tu n'ajoutes pas un horaire mais tu le respécifies
Bref:
- "08:00-19:00;12:00-14:00 off" est équivalente à "08:00- 12:00;14:00-
19:00"
- "08:00-19:00;Sa-Su off" est équivalente à "Mo-Th 08:00-19:00"
- "Mo-Sa 08:00-19:00;Sa 18:00-19:00 off" est équivalente à "Mo-Th
08:00-19:00;Sa 08:00-18:00"
Tu peux tester, c'est comme ça que ça marche.
Les
Le mar. 31 déc. 2019 à 09:18, Jérôme Seigneuret
a écrit :
> Le ; est une règle cumulative avec écrasement des valeurs passés.
>
> Si tu met Lundi au Vendredi de 10 à 20h et que tu ajoutes Mercredi de 20h
> à 22h c'est pas cumulatif. Tu dis juste de remplacer les horaires de
> Mercredi
>
C'est
Le ; est une règle cumulative avec écrasement des valeurs passés.
Si tu met Lundi au Vendredi de 10 à 20h et que tu ajoutes Mercredi de 20h à
22h c'est pas cumulatif. Tu dis juste de remplacer les horaires de Mercredi
Dans ce cas il faut utiliser le *|| *et non* ; *
L'évaluation se fait de
Le lun. 30 déc. 2019 à 21:02, Jérôme Seigneuret
a écrit :
> Salut,
> "Journée continue" n'est pas nécessaire si l'on utilise le mot clé "off".
> Attention YoHours ne prend pas en compte toute la syntaxe de opening_hours
> exemple complet pour les vacances
>
>
Salut,
"Journée continue" n'est pas nécessaire si l'on utilise le mot clé "off".
Attention YoHours ne prend pas en compte toute la syntaxe de opening_hours
exemple complet pour les vacances
Pour gagner un peu on pourrait proposer d'autoriser les heures et minutes à
1 chiffre au lieu de 2 (sans zéro initial) quand elles sont séparés par un
":".
Certains espaces sont non nécessaires dans la syntaxe : entre n'importe
quelle lettre et n'importe quel chiffre, et toutes les ponctuations
La première partie des horaires, hors vacances (SH), se factorise un peu
(en utilisant "off" pour fermer un horaire déclaré ouvert dans les règles
précédentes):
Mo-Fr 11:45-14:00,17:00-20:00;
We 11:30-11:45;
Mo 11:45-12:00 off;
We 13:00-14:00,18:00-20:00 off;
Tu 20:00-21:00;
Mais on gagne très
> J’ai essayé ceci
>
> Je n'arrive pas, pour le moment, à trouver comment faire : mettre les mêmes
> horaires de début pour les vacances et hors vacances et de préciser en SH
> Mo-Fr « Ouverture en continue »
J’ai essayé ceci
Le 28/12/2019 à 17:08, Yves P. a écrit :
Ce n’est pas factorisable ☹️
A moins de mettre les mêmes horaires de début pour les vacances et
hors vacances et de préciser en SH Mo-Fr « Ouverture en continue »
Il manque une virgule entre les 2 « blocs » et il n’y en a pas à la fin
J'ai
14 matches
Mail list logo